Understanding HS Codes

The Harmonized System (HS) is a standardized numerical method of classifying traded products. It is used by customs authorities worldwide to identify products for the application of duties and taxes. The HS code for postage and revenue stamps falls under Chapter 97 of the Harmonized System, which covers "Works of art, collectors' pieces, and antiques."

HS Code for Postage and Revenue Stamps

The specific HS code for postage and revenue stamps is 9704.00. This classification includes:

  • Postage stamps
  • Revenue stamps
  • Stamp-postmarks
  • First-day covers
  • Postal stationery (stamped paper)
  • Similar items, used or unused, other than those of heading 4907

It's important to note that this HS code applies to both used and unused stamps, making it relevant for stamp collections, rare stamps, and various philately items.

Additional Considerations for Shipping Stamps

When shipping stamp collections or rare stamps internationally, consider the following tips:

  1. Proper Packaging: Use sturdy, waterproof packaging to protect stamps from damage during transit.
  2. Documentation: Include detailed descriptions and valuations for customs purposes.
  3. Insurance: Consider additional insurance coverage for high-value stamp collections.
  4. Import/Export Regulations: Be aware of any specific regulations for importing or exporting stamps in different countries.
  5. Declared Value: Ensure accurate declaration of value to avoid customs issues.
